The National Wax Museum was broken into and figures vandalised.
Report shows exterior of museum showing closed sign due to break in. Views of vandalised and damaged displays and wax work figures. Including a 1916 display models of John F Kennedy, Wolfe Tone, Margaret Thatcher defaced and damaged with sword. Damaged figures from Gaelic Athletic Association (GAA) display. Models of Prince and Princess of Wales undamaged.
Interview with Patrick Fagan on estimated cost of the damage.
The reporter is Eileen Dunne.
